Skip to content

CI: Add dependabot workflow to update github actions#5995

Merged
wyli merged 1 commit intoProject-MONAI:devfrom
jamesobutler:dependabot-workflow
Feb 15, 2023
Merged

CI: Add dependabot workflow to update github actions#5995
wyli merged 1 commit intoProject-MONAI:devfrom
jamesobutler:dependabot-workflow

Conversation

@jamesobutler
Copy link
Copy Markdown
Contributor

@jamesobutler jamesobutler commented Feb 15, 2023

Description

This adds a dependabot workflow to update github actions versions as I have noticed deprecations in some of the recent runs here in https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/Project-MONAI/MONAI/actions.

This is like what was integrated at Project-MONAI/MONAILabel@2ee812a which resulted in automatically created PRs to update outdated github actions in Project-MONAI/MONAILabel#1310 and Project-MONAI/MONAILabel#1311.

Once this is integrated, auto created PRs by dependabot will be opened.

Types of changes

  • Non-breaking change (fix or new feature that would not break existing functionality).
  • Breaking change (fix or new feature that would cause existing functionality to change).
  • New tests added to cover the changes.
  • Integration tests passed locally by running ./runtests.sh -f -u --net --coverage.
  • Quick tests passed locally by running ./runtests.sh --quick --unittests --disttests.
  • In-line docstrings updated.
  • Documentation updated, tested make html command in the docs/ folder.

@wyli
Copy link
Copy Markdown
Contributor

wyli commented Feb 15, 2023

/build

@wyli wyli enabled auto-merge (squash) February 15, 2023 08:23
@wyli wyli merged commit 9ddb14c into Project-MONAI:dev Feb 15, 2023
@jamesobutler jamesobutler deleted the dependabot-workflow branch February 15, 2023 13: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ants